Ferry Boat Accidents

Ferry boats are often large vessels for commuters that can carry lots of passengers. They can also be quite quick, which means that injuries sustained in a ferry boat accident may be very grave. These accidents could result in collisions with docks, other boats, or objects and can result in injuries from impact, such as concussions, broken bones, or broken bones. These accidents could also involve falling and slipping down the stairs that aren't well lit or on other walkways, or being thrown about the vessel's cabin as it moves in the water.

In the majority cases, those who suffer injuries in a boating accident could be awarded substantial compensation. This could include medical expenses along with lost wages, pain and suffering. The amount you receive will be contingent on the severity of the injury and how long it takes you to recover.

In many instances the owner or operator of a ferry may be held accountable for the accident and the resulting injuries in the event they violated their obligation to exercise reasonable care and competence when operating the vessel. A successful negligence claim must be based on evidence that shows what caused the accident and that a prudent and reasonable boat operator would have avoided the incident when they had taken the proper actions.

Additionally, crew members who are employed on a ferry vessel might be able to sue under federal laws governing admiralty and maritime including The Jones Act. This law safeguards any US crew member who is injured while working aboard an US commercial vessel.

Boating Accidents Caused by Intoxication

While it might be tempting to think of bodies water as a wild west, the reality is that they're highly controlled. Boating accidents are often governed by state and federal law, and can even be governed by maritime law.

Many boating accidents are caused by the same factors that cause car accidents, such as excessive speeding drinking and driving and reckless driving. Alcohol consumption is particularly dangerous when on the water, since it can alter the coordination and balance, cause fatigue, and impair judgement. These issues can result in life-changing injuries.

It is illegal to operate a vehicle when under the under the influence. In fact, it is among the most common causes of boating accidents and deaths. Those who violate this law could face the same penalties if found driving while impaired.

Boating accidents can result in serious injuries like neck and back burns, brain injuries and broken bones. These injuries can have a long-term impact on a person's quality of life and ability to work. These injuries can be extremely expensive to treat, and may require a lifetime of care.
